R-82-480 - 10/14/1982RESOLUTION NO. dine, RESOLUTION OF THE CITY COUNCIL OF THE CITY OF ROUND ROCK, TEXAS, MAKING FINDINGS THAT A GEOGRAPHICAL AREA OF THE CITY OF ROUND ROCK IS A BLIGHTED OR ECONOMICALLY DEPRESSED AREA FOR THE PURPOSE OF FINANCING OF PROJECTS FOR COMMERCIAL USES UNDER THE DEVELOPMENT CORPORATION ACT OF 1979 (ARTICLE 5190.6) AS AMENDED: SUCH GEOGRAPHICAL AREA DEFINED IN EXHIBIT "A" AS A REINVESTMENT ZONE; REQUESTING THE TEXAS INDUSTRIAL COMMISSION TO APPROVE COMMER- CIAL PROJECTS WITHIN SUCH DEPRESSED AREAS; DESCRIBING THE TYPE OF PROJECTS FOR COMMERCIAL USES DESIRED AND AUTHORIZED BY THE CITY OF ROUND ROCK; AND REPRESENTING THAT CITY COUNCIL WILL REVIEW ALL PROJECT DESCRIPTIONS. WHEREAS, the City Council of the City of Round Rock gave due and proper notice of public hearing pursuant to Article 5190.6, as amended, Vernon's Civil Statutes (the "Act ") and the Regulations (the "Regulations ") of the Texas Industrial Commission, to be held on this date for the purpose of designating certain areas of the City as a Reinvestment Zone (the "Blighted Areas" or "Economically Depressed Areas ") under and for the purposes of the Act and the Regulations; and WHEREAS, the City Council has found that notice was properly given and published as required by the Act and the Regulations, that the public hearing was held on this date in accordance with law, that the public was given the oppor- tunity to be and was heard on the proposal submitted, and that the City Council has given due and proper regard to the testimony presented; and WHEREAS, while considerable residential - related activi- ties have been undertaken in the area during the past ten years, few programs have been available to provide leverage or incentive for commercial development. This is clearly not in conformance with the City Council's long -range plan for the area which indicates a balanced community with commer- cial, retail, light industrial and residential elements; and WHEREAS, the City Council has found and determined that the City of Round Rock's economic base depends in substantial part on manufacturing and industrial activities, and commer- cial and tourist activities, and that by virtue of the conditions recited, the City of Round Rock is experiencing a need for an increased tax base, increased commercial activi- ties and a need for jobs of a character suitable for its unemployed population, that the provisions of the Act and Regulations will assist the City of Round Rock in achieving these objectives in the Reinvestment Zone and the City as a whole, and that the availability of financing of projects for commercial uses under the Act and the Regulations will contribute significantly to the alleviation of the blighted conditions found to exist in the City of Round Rock; NOW, THEREFORE, BE IT RESOLVED BY THE CITY COUNCIL OF THE CITY OF ROUND ROCK, TEXAS (1) That the determinations and findings recited and declared in the preambles to this Resolution are hereby restated, repeated and incorporated herein as the current, proper and lawful findings of the City Council; (2) That the area within the corporate limits of the City of Round Rock is hereby designated as a Blighted Area under and for the purposes of the Act and the Regulations; (3) That the City Council request the Texas Industrial Commission to approve commercial projects for financing under the Act and the Regulations within the Blighted Areas of the following types, to -wit: (a) Major Office complexes. (b) Commercial facilities. (c) Convention and related facilities. (d) Hotel /Motel and related facilities. (e) Any other commercial activities contributing to revitalization and providing services to neighborhood residents located within and adjacent to redevelopment areas. - 2 - (4) That the City Council of the City of Round Rock represents that it will review all project descriptions for approval of specific projects for commercial uses and in order to determine whether such projects are consistent with the City's objectives for redevelopment and rehabilitation of the Blighted Areas designated herein; (5) This Resolution shall take effect immediately from and after its adoption.
